What are the most common types of addiction treatment programs available in Newton, NC?

In Newton, NC, residents can access a range of programs including outpatient counseling, intensive outpatient programs (IOP), and medication-assisted treatment (MAT) for opioid and alcohol use disorders. Local facilities like Daymark Recovery Services and the Catawba Valley Behavioral Healthcare Center offer these services, with some providing specialized care for co-occurring mental health conditions. Additionally, nearby residential treatment centers in Hickory or Charlotte are often utilized for more intensive care.

How can I verify if a rehab center in Newton, NC, accepts my insurance?

To verify insurance acceptance, contact Newton-based facilities like Daymark Recovery Services directly or check their websites for a list of accepted insurers, which often include Medicaid, Medicare, and private plans like Blue Cross NC. You can also call your insurance provider to confirm in-network coverage for specific treatment centers in Catawba County, as coverage can vary based on your plan and the level of care needed.

Are there any local support groups or aftercare resources in Newton, NC, for ongoing recovery?

Yes, Newton and the surrounding Catawba County area offer several support groups, including Narcotics Anonymous (NA) and Alcoholics Anonymous (AA) meetings held at local churches and community centers. Organizations like the Catawba Valley Behavioral Healthcare Center can also connect individuals with peer support specialists and outpatient aftercare programs to help maintain sobriety post-treatment.

What should I expect during the intake process at a rehab center in Newton, NC?

The intake process at Newton rehab centers typically involves a comprehensive assessment of your substance use, mental health, and medical history to create a personalized treatment plan. You'll likely discuss insurance and payment options, and facilities may require proof of residency in Catawba County or North Carolina for certain state-funded programs. This process helps determine whether outpatient care in Newton or a referral to a residential facility elsewhere is most appropriate.

How do I choose the right addiction treatment center in Newton, NC, for a family member?

Start by evaluating local options like Daymark Recovery Services for their specialties, such as treating co-occurring disorders or offering family therapy programs. Consider factors like proximity to home for outpatient care, the center's accreditation (e.g., through the NC Division of Mental Health), and reviews from other Catawba County residents. Consulting with a primary care doctor in Newton or contacting the Catawba County Health Department for referrals can also provide guidance tailored to your family's needs.
